Output 25995af570c6a676f75c1ea56ec55a7e6cefadbd120f898e19f1f11d1d8e0852:3

value
109600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ed836c2daf7bd588807035592f3a89b9fdb31af7 OP_EQUAL
address
3PLsWQcd2bxnbiwF3xQz8AnHuS91Y5ffSs
transaction
25995af570c6a676f75c1ea56ec55a7e6cefadbd120f898e19f1f11d1d8e0852
spent
true